Tsunami Maritime Hazard Assessement for Westport, WA

Work in progress, 2021-2022

This modeling project by Carrie Garrison-Laney and Randall LeVeque and Loyce Adams will be submitted to EMD, WGS DNR and Westport, WA for use in designing a maritime hazard plan for Westport Harbor, WA. This project was funded in part by Washington State Emergency Management Division (EMD).

Note: Graphics and animations on this page are for research and development purposes only, official maps will eventually be published by Washington State as part of their Maritime Guidance.

Animations of particle tracking (under construction)

Massless tracer particles help visualize the water motion and how lightweight floating objects might move with it. This is not a realistic model for the motion of large-scale debris or boats, whose motion depends on its mass, drag factors, etc. and which might be grounded and stationary in sufficiently shallow water.
